Originally Posted by yazid
Hey Roswell, I've been wondering why my H&R springs have lowered the car significantly. I'm sure we have the same car, although my setup is from a P30. Whats this "OEM rear spring pads" you mentioned?

I'm thinking to raise the rear shocks by about 15mm. Think this can be done?
Our rear suspension use 14mm spring pads stock, but I find the rear to be lower than the front with these pads. That's why I bought the 17mm spring pads (recommended by superbubblicity).. They are very cheap at the dealership , like 20$ for the pair.. And they will raise the rear a bit (3mm), just enough to match the front height.
